§ 27A-10-18 — Refusal of admission and commitment when medical condition exceeds center's capacity.

Text
The center may refuse the admission and commitment of a person under this chapter who has a medical condition which exceeds the capacity of the center.

Legislative History
SL 1995, ch 158, § 3.
